Output 50d175aa96b91e98f941ea122ed686f19f848aa4eb4c3cd19ea05b7055fc3c03:7

value
8116633
script pubkey
OP_0 OP_PUSHBYTES_20 8527253631d6ce71d22c0a98f7322bf6e44f44d2
address
ltc1qs5nj2d336m88r53vp2v0wv3t7mjy73xjg5xrnt
transaction
50d175aa96b91e98f941ea122ed686f19f848aa4eb4c3cd19ea05b7055fc3c03
spent
true